Usage & contexts

Examples

  • He felt great sorrow (悲伤) at the news.
  • The story has a tragic ending (悲剧).
  • She expressed sympathy for the victims (悲悯).
  • The music sounded mournful (悲哀).

Collocations

  • sadness(悲伤)
  • tragedy(悲剧)
  • compassion(悲悯)
  • grief(悲哀)
  • lament(悲叹)
  • joy and sorrow(悲欢)

Idioms

  • Joy and sorrow are interwoven(悲欢离合)
  • Extreme joy begets sorrow(乐极生悲)
  • Mourn for others' woes(悲天悯人)

  • In Chinese philosophy, 悲 is one of the fundamental human emotions, often contrasted with 喜 (joy).
  • Buddhist concept of 慈悲 (compassion) combines 悲 (pity/compassion) with 慈 (kindness).
  • Traditional Chinese aesthetics values the expression of 悲 as a profound emotional experience in literature and art.
